The water solubility determination of test item 3-methylsulphanilic acid (CAS No. 98-33-9) was done as per the OECD guideline 105 and by spectrophotometric analytical method as per OECD 101

Considering the water solubility for 48 hrs and 72 hrs the mean water solubility was calculated as follows:

Mean water solubility value for 48 hour run sample + 72 hour run sample

=(5574.68+6668.24)/2

=6121.46 mg/L

Conclusions:
The water solubility determination of test item 3-methylsulphanilic acid (CAS No.98-33-9) was done by spectrophotometric method. The water solubility was determined to be 6121.46 mg/L at 30°C.

WSKOW v1.42 was used to estimate the water solubility of 4-amino-3-methylbenzenesulfonic acid.

Water solubility of 3-methylsulphanilic acid was estimated to be 10380 mg/l at 25 deg C.

The experimental and estimated values suggest that 4-amino-3-methylbenzenesulfonic acid is highly soluble in water.
